The Role

The Product Development Group is seeking a Product Development Engineer to help deliver next-generation datacenter platforms powered by AMD CPU and GPU technologies. Supporting AI, Machine Learning (ML), and High-Performance Computing (HPC) workloads, these systems are deployed in some of the world's most demanding datacenter environments.

In this role, you will work across hardware, firmware, software, manufacturing, and operations teams to drive products from initial system bring-up through validation, manufacturing readiness, production ramp, and volume deployment. You will have the opportunity to solve complex system-level challenges, influence product quality and reliability, and contribute to innovative technologies that power the future of AI infrastructure.

Key Responsibilities
  • Drive system bring-up, validation, and debug activities for AMD datacenter platforms, including boards, servers, and rack-scale systems.
  • Develop and execute validation strategies to ensure product quality, performance, reliability, and manufacturability.
  • Investigate and resolve complex hardware, firmware, and software issues across CPU, GPU, memory, networking, power, thermal, and platform subsystems.
  • Partner with silicon, board, BIOS, firmware, software, manufacturing, and operations teams to enable successful product development and deployment.
  • Develop and support manufacturing test, diagnostic, and automation solutions that improve product readiness and factory efficiency.
  • Analyze validation and production data to identify root causes, improve yield, and drive corrective actions.
  • Support new product introductions, manufacturing ramp activities, and high-volume production.
  • Influence product quality and testability through DFT reviews, process improvements, and engineering best practices.
  • Provide technical leadership through problem solving, cross-functional collaboration, and mentoring of junior engineers.
Preferred Experience
  • Experience in system validation, product development, test engineering, or manufacturing engineering.
  • Hands-on experience with datacenter, server, storage, CPU, GPU, or accelerator-based platforms.
  • Understanding of AI infrastructure, AI workloads, or large-scale computing environments.
  • Experience debugging system-level hardware, firmware, and software issues.
  • Familiarity with Linux environments and scripting languages such as Python, Bash, or similar.
  • Knowledge of technologies including PCIe, networking, memory architectures, power delivery, thermal management, and system firmware.
  •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and communication skills with the ability to work effectively across global teams.
ACADEMIC CREDENTIALS
  • Bachelor's degree preferred in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, or a related technical discipline.
  • Advanced degree is a plus.
